simSaveImage
Saves an image to file or to memory
C++ synopsis
simSaveImage(const unsigned char* image, const int* resolution, int options, const char* filename,
int quality, void* reserved)
Arguments
- image: a pointer to rgb, rgba or greyscale values.
- resolution: the x/y resolution of the provided image.
- options: bit-coded. If bit0 and bit1 represent the format of the provided image (0=rgb, 1=rgba, 2=greyscale).
- filename: the name of the file to write. The file extension indicates the format.
- quality: the quality of the written image: 0 for best compression, 100 for largest file. Use -1 for default behaviour.
- reserved: Reserved for future extension. Set to nullptr.
Return
- -1 if operation was not successful.
